The book presents technical developments in the IoT sector, sensors and smart agriculture machines, as well as solutions to digitize the farmer's life by delivering holistic management platforms and monitoring systems.
The papers presented in the book are proceedings of the conference “Fundamental and Applied Scientific Research in the Development of Agriculture in the Far East (AFE-2021)”, which took place in Ussuriysk, Russia.
Innovative developments in the field of precision livestock farming, application of fertilizers of a new generation and production of eco-friendly products are presented here.
